Europe battles new Covid surge
November 15, 2021 - European countries are starting to impose new lockdowns as governments struggle to contain record coronavirus cases across the continent.
Austria introduced a lockdown on people unvaccinated against the coronavirus on Monday as winter approaches, with Germany considering tighter curbs and Britain expanding its booster programme to younger adults.
In the Netherlands, “lockdown-lite” measures have been imposed to limit social contacts in response to a sharp increase in infections.
Europe has again become the epicentre of the pandemic, prompting some countries to consider re-imposing restrictions in the run-up to Christmas and stirring debate over whether vaccines alone are enough to tame Covid-19.
